It comes from the Sorì Tildìn vineyard in Barbaresco, acquired by the Gaja family in 1967 and first bottled separately in 1970. In the Piedmontese dialect, “Sorì” refers to the sun-favoured top of a hillside, while “Tildìn” was the affectionate nickname of Clotilde Rey, an important figure in the Gaja family’s history. Classified as Langhe Nebbiolo DOC, the 2006 vintage was produced predominantly from Nebbiolo with a small proportion of Barbera.
The vineyard lies at approximately 270 metres above sea level on soils composed mainly of marl, clay and limestone, giving the wine depth, structure and a distinctive mineral character. Fermentation and maceration take place in stainless-steel tanks, followed by approximately twelve months in barriques and a further twelve months in large oak casks. In the glass, Sorì Tildìn 2006 displays a deep garnet colour and a layered bouquet of ripe cherry, red berries, rose petals, spices, cedar, graphite, truffle and balsamic nuances. The palate is elegant and concentrated, with fine, integrated tannins, lively freshness and a remarkably long, aromatic and polished finish.
A fine wine for contemplation and important occasions, it pairs beautifully with braised beef, roast meats, game, lamb, truffle-based dishes and mature cheeses. Serve at approximately 16-18 °C. The bottle should preferably be stood upright before opening, with decanting assessed gently according to its condition. As with any mature collectable wine, aromatic development may vary depending on storage history and the individual bottle.
